Thomas
Panek
has
completed
20
marathons,
however,
he
made
history
on
Sunday
at
the
New
York
City
Half
Marathon.
While
visually
impaired(视觉障碍)runners
usually
use
human
guides,
Mr
Panek
became
the
first
person
to
complete
the
race
supported
by
guide
dogs.
A
trio
of
Labradors
-
Westley,
Waffle
and
Gus
-
each
accompanied
(陪伴)
him
for
a
third
of
the
race.
The
team
finished
in
two
hours
and
21
minutes.
Mr
Panek,
who
lost
his
sight
in
his
early
20s,
showed
that
while
he
appreciated
the
support
of
human
volunteers,
he
missed
the
feeling
of
independence.
In
2015,
Mr
Panek
established
the
Running
Guides
programme
which
trains
dogs
to
support
runners.
When
selecting
his
companions
for
the
race,
Mr
Panek
chose
siblings
Waffle
and
Westley
to
join
Gus,
who
is
his
full-time
guide
dog.
“The
relationship
is
really
important.
You
can’t
just
pick
up
the
harness
(挽带)
and
go
for
a
run
with
these
dogs,”
Mr
Panek
said.
“You’re
training
with
a
team
no
matter
what
kind
of
athlete
you
are,
and
you
want
to
spend
time
together
in
that
training
camp.”
Each
dogs
sets
its
own
pace
—
Westley
runs
an
eight
minute
mile,
while
his
sister
Waffle
can
cover
the
same
distance
in
six
minutes—and
helps
Mr
Panek
avoid
obstacles
such
as
kerbs(路缘)and
cones
(椎体).
Each
dog
wears
a
special
harness
and
set
of
running
boots,
to
protect
their
paws.
Gus
was
chosen
to
run
the
final
leg
of
the
race
and
cross
the
finish
line
with
Mr
Panek.
He
retired
from
his
duties
as
a
guide
dog
at
the
end
of
the
race.
According
to
Mr
Panek,
guide
dogs
give
visually
impaired
people
the
freedom
to
“do
whatever
it
is
a
sighted
person
does,
and
sometimes,
even
run
a
little
faster
than
them”.

The
idea
of
turning
recycled
plastic
bottles
into
clothing
is
not
new.
During
the
past
five
years,
a
large
number
of
clothing
companies,
businesses
and
environmental
organizations
have
started
turning
plastics
into
fabric
to
deal
with
plastic
pollution.
But
there’s
a
problem
with
this
method.
Research
now
shows
that
microfibers
(微纤维)
could
be
the
biggest
source
of
plastic
in
the
sea.
Dr.
Mark
Browne
in
Santa
Barbara,
California,
has
been
studying
plastic
pollution
and
microfibers
for
10
years.
He
explains
that
every
time
synthetic
(合成的)
clothes
go
into
a
washing
machine,
a
large
number
of
plastic
fibers
fall
off.
Most
washing
machines
can’t
collect
these
microfibers.
So
every
time
the
water
gets
out
of
a
washing
machine,
microfibers
enter
the
sewer
and
finally
end
up
in
the
sea.
In
2011,
Browne
wrote
a
paper
stating
that
a
single
piece
of
synthetic
clothing
can
produce
more
than
1,900
fibers
per
wash.
Browne
collected
samples
(样本)
from
seawater
and
freshwater
sites
around
the
world,
and
used
a
special
way
to
examine
each
sample.
He
discovered
that
every
single
water
sample
contained
microfibers.
This
is
bad
news
for
a
number
of
reasons.
Plastic
can
cause
harm
to
sea
life
when
eaten.
Studies
have
also
shown
that
plastic
can
absorb
(吸收)
other
pollutants.
Based
on
this
evidence,
it
may
seem
surprising
that
companies
and
organizations
have
chosen
to
turn
plastic
waste
into
clothing
as
an
environmental
“solution”.
Even
though
the
science
has
been
around
for
a
while,
Browne
explains
that
he’s
had
a
difficult
time
getting
companies
to
listen.
When
he
asked
well-known
clothing
companies
to
support
Benign
by
Design,
his
research
project
that
seeks
to
get
clothes
that
have
a
bad
effect
on
humans
and
the
environment
out
of
the
market,
Browne
didn’t
get
a
satisfying
answer.
Only
one
women’s
clothing
company,
Eileen
Fisher,
offered
Browne
funding.

Don’t
know
how
to
take
care
of
your
plants?
A
little
spider-like
robot
will
chase
the
sunlight,
run
to
shade,
dance
when
it’s
doing
well
and
stomp
(跺脚)
when
it
needs
to
be
watered.
It’s
called
the
HEXA
Plant,
a
six-legged
machine
created
by
Vincross,
a
robotics
company
in
Beijing,
China.
The
robot
plant
will
crawl
toward
the
sunlight
when
it
needs
it,
then
will
rotate
(转动)
when
it
enjoys
the
sun
in
order
to
absorb
its
rays
on
all
sides.
When
it
needs
to
cool
off,
it
will
look
for
shade.
It
also
plays
with
humans
and
dances
when
it
is
happy,
moving
its
legs
up
and
down.
But
it
gets
“angry”
when
it’s
thirsty
by
stomping
its
legs.
With
six
legs,
the
HEXA
Plant
can
move
anywhere-in
any
direction
and
around
any
objects
in
its
path.
It’s
even
nimble
enough
to
navigate
(导航)
unexpected
drops,
like
if
it
had
to
suddenly
step
over
a
gap
between
two
tabletops.
It
has
a
variety
of
“eyes”,
including
an
infrared
sensor
(红外线感应器),
a
distance
sensor,
and
a
720p
camera
with
night
vision,
which
could
be
very
handy
if
you
want
it
to
send
it
out
like
a
guard
dog
at
night,
to
go
check
on
any
sudden
noises.
It
has
a
built-in
Wifi
as
well
as
various
ports
(USB)
to
expand
its
many
talents.
So
sure,
it’
s
not
as
cute
as
a
garden
gnome
(守护精灵),
but
it
can
do
a
lot
more
than
just
stand
there
and
look
cute.
The
inventor
of
the
cute
robot,
Sun
Tiangi,
was
inspired
by
a
dead
sunflower.
He
had
idea
why
it
died-whether
it
was
because
of
the
lack
of
sunshine
or
water.
That’s
when
he
had
the
idea
for
the
walking
plant.
He
says
plants
are
passive.
He
wants
to
allow
plants
to
experience
movement.
